Fifty-Five T'ang Poemsby Hugh M. Stimson
Synopses & ReviewsPublisher Comments:Four masters of the shi form of Chinese poetry, who are generally considered to be giants in the entire history of Chinese literature, are represented in this book: three from the eighth century, and one from the ninth. A few works by other well-known poets are also included. The author provides a general background sketch, instruction to the student, a description of the phonological system and the spelling used, as well as an outline of the grammar of T'ang shi, insofar as it is known.
